Job description

LocationWhite Plains, New YorkShift:Day (United States of America)Description:Social Worker - Eating Disorders Track - Part-TimeAs a Social Worker in the eating disorders track, you will work closely with an interdisciplinary team to provide individual and group psychotherapy and discharge planning toadultpatients.Here the patient'sbenefit from the latest clinical research findings and advances in the treatment of eating disorders such as anorexia nervosa, avoidant/restrictive food intake disorder (ARFID), bulimia nervosa, binge eating disorder, and related disorders. We understand that eating disorders are serious illnesses, and we also believe that recovery is possible.Experience a place where your discipline is immensely respected.As part of your role you will receive weekly expert supervision.Shift details: In person 4 days a week. Approximately 4.5 hours a shift.Preferred Criteria
  • Licensed Clinical Social Worker (LCSW)
  • 3 to 5 years of experience in the treatment ofpsychiatric patients
  • Experience with eating disorders or commitment to working with this population
  • Training inevidence-based treatments for eating disorders (e.g., CBT-E, CBT-AR, FBT)
  • Competency in individual, family and group treatment modalities and treatment techniques appropriate tooutpatient treatment setting
Required Criteria
  • Licensed Masters Social Worker (LMSW)
  • At least 3 years of experience in the treatment ofpsychiatric patients
  • Limited Permit (must supply exam date prior to start of employment)
  • Fieldwork or previous experience in a psychiatric setting usingevidence-based treatments.
  • Knowledge base of bio-psychosocial model, DSM-V diagnoses, criteria for treatment of different diagnoses, behavioral risk factors and of the impact of mental illness upon individual and family functioning
  • Knowledge base of community and discharge planning resources and processes
  • Experience using an electronic medical record
